Некоторые подходы к хранению изображений в веб-приложениях:
Древовидная структура хранения. habr.com Позволяет избежать ситуации с тысячами файлов в одной папке, которая тормозит работу файловой системы. habr.com Лучше использовать вложенную структуру из папок длиной в два символа. habr.com
Обработка изображений после загрузки на сервер. habr.com Нужно уменьшить размер файлов, удалить все метаданные и провести оптимизацию для уменьшения размера файлов. habr.com Для этого можно использовать инструменты, например ImageMagick, GraphicsMagick и Jpegtran. habr.com
Использование облачных решений. habr.com Например, хранилища S3, которые условно бесконечны и позволяют платить только за то, сколько места используется. websecret.by
Хранение изображений на клиенте с помощью API IndexedDB. sky.pro Для этого создают структуру базы данных и сохраняют изображения через put, предварительно закодировав их в формате Base64 или в виде блобов. sky.pro
Выбор подхода зависит от конкретных условий и требований проекта.
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.